What are good timings for walking?

9 views
Morning strolls, ideally before 8 a.m., offer a refreshing start to the day. A brisk 30-minute walk suffices. Alternatively, a post-dinner evening walk provides beneficial exercise and contributes to overall wellness, adapting to individual schedules.

Benefits Galore: A Path to Vitality

Whether you embrace the refreshing embrace of dawn or the tranquility of dusk, walking bestows myriad benefits upon your well-being:

  • Enhanced cardiovascular health
  • Reduced risk of chronic diseases
  • Improved mood and cognitive function
  • Strengthened bones and muscles
  • Reduced stress and anxiety
